If you have ever had braces, you are likely familiar with the discomfort that can come with them. One of the most common sources of pain for those with braces is the irritation caused by the metal brackets and wires rubbing against the soft tissues inside the mouth. This constant friction can lead to sores, cuts, and overall discomfort. Fortunately, there is a simple solution that can help alleviate this pain: mouth wax for braces.
Mouth wax is a commonly used product that can provide relief for those with braces. It is a soft, moldable wax that can be applied to the brackets and wires of the braces in order to create a smooth surface and reduce friction. This can help to prevent the wires from rubbing against the inside of the mouth, reducing the likelihood of sores and cuts.

Another benefit of using mouth wax for braces is that it is easy to apply and remove. The wax comes in small containers that can easily be carried around and applied whenever needed. To apply the wax, simply pinch off a small piece, roll it into a ball, and press it onto the brackets and wires of the braces. The wax will adhere to the braces and create a smooth surface. When it is time to remove the wax, simply peel it off the braces and discard it.
